Limassol is a city located in the south east if Cyprus. It is the capital of the Eponymous District. Limassol is the second largest city in Cyprus and has a population of around 101,000. Limassol is home to the Cyprus University of Technology and was established in 2004. The university offers 6 faculties which are; Geotechnical Sciences, Environmental Management and Economics, Communication and Media studies, Health Sciences, Fine and Applied Arts, Engineering and Technology and Language. Another university is the Frederick University which is a private university. The school was established in 1965 and offers research and teaching in areas such as science, technology, letters and the arts.
